Blackstone Inc

Blackstone (BX) trades at $141.67, up 3.31% today, near its consensus price target of $144.00. The stock shows strong bullish technical signals and has consistently beaten earnings estimates in recent quarters. Recent news highlights strategic acquisitions, including a stake in Air Canada's Aeroplan program and a $25.3 billion Australian home loan portfolio purchase from HSBC, signaling aggressive growth and diversification.

Outlook remains positive with robust revenue growth and high profitability, though elevated valuation ratios and overbought RSI levels suggest near-term caution. Key risks include market volatility and integration challenges from recent deals. Analyst consensus is strongly bullish, supporting a favorable long-term view.

Seagate Technology Holdings PLC

Seagate Technology (STX) trades at $800.74, down 1.48% today, with a bearish technical signal but strong recent earnings beats driven by AI storage demand. The company reported Q2 2026 EPS of $5.71, beating expectations of $5.10, with revenue growth and margin expansion supported by its HAMR technology and data center contracts. However, high valuation ratios (P/E 59.03, P/S 15.41) and negative shareholder equity pose fundamental concerns.

The outlook is mixed: AI-driven demand and analyst bullishness (54.91% buy ratings) support upside to the $1,130 consensus target, but elevated valuation, legal settlements, and competitive pressures in the storage market present significant risks. Cash flow volatility and debt levels require monitoring for sustained growth.

About Blackstone Inc

Blackstone is one of the world's largest alternative asset managers with $940.8 billion in total asset under management, including $683.8 billion in fee-earning asset under management, at the end of June 2022.

About Seagate Technology Holdings PLC

Seagate is a leading supplier of hard disk drives for data storage to the enterprise and consumer markets. It forms a practical duopoly in the market with its chief rival, Western Digital
